NJ's Tax Collections Boost Budget, Narrow Deficit
from Jersey City News Today | 2 Min News | The Daily News Now!
New Jerseys tax collections surpass expectations, narrowing the states budget gap to $1.5 billion. Governor Sherrills proposed $60.7 billion budget for the upcoming year gains traction, but lawmakers debate spending priorities and tax changes. Despite improved outlook, uncertainties persist, and the states surplus remains a concern, potentially impacting credit ratings.
